找到.condarc文件,一般在家目录里,在 Windows 系统中是 C:\Users\<你的用户名>\.condarc
删除.condarc文件,这里我是重命名
重新创建一个.condarc文件:
conda config --set show_channel_urls yes
尝试创建环境
conda create --name Pytorch python=3.10
报错,就接着加或者换源,查看自己的.condarc文件里有没有这些源,没有就加,有看一致不一致
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/conda-forge/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/msys2/
conda config --set show_channel_urls yes
如果还报错
在.condarc文件加上下面这段代码
show_channel_urls: true channel_alias: http://mirrors.tuna.tsinghua.edu.cn/anaconda default_channels: - http://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main - http://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free - http://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/r - http://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/pro - http://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/msys2 custom_channels: conda-forge: http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ud msys2: http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ud bioconda: http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ud menpo: http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ud pytorch: http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ud simpleitk: http://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ud channels: - defaults ssl_verify: true
完成!整了一天,人都麻了。。。
必要的时候,关掉梯子,重启,都试试,主要还是.condarc文件.
这之间可能还会出现一个创建失败的环境,删除重建!